Recommended Wiring Harness And Brake Controller for 2008 Nissan Pathfinder With Factory Tow Package
Question:
I have a 2008 Nissan Pathfinder with the tow package from the factory and I need to add the capability to tow a trailer w/ electric brakes. I believe part# C56226 is what will work. Is there one or more brake controllers available for this application and can you recommend one that is a direct plug in unit?
asked by: Tom
Expert Reply:
For your 2008 Pathfinder I recommend the T-One Wiring Harness with a 7-way trailer connector, part # 118266. This harness plugs into the existing wiring on your Pathfinder and that measns no cutting or splicing into the wiring. This gives you a 7-way at the rear of your vehicle. I also recommend the Pollak mounting bracket, part # PK12711U. The # C56226 harness will also work with your vehicle but we have had very good reviews from customers when using the T-One harness.
When working with electrical connectors I recommend using dielectric grease like part # 11755. This keeps dirt and moisture out of the electrical connections and helps prevent corrosion.
The brake controller I recommend the P3 Brake Controller, part # 90195. This is one of our most popular brake controllers because it is easy to install and operate.
For your Pathfinder with the factory tow package you can use a plug-in harness part # 3050-P. One end plugs into the back of the controller and the other end plugs into the brake controller port located underneath the dash, to the left of the steering column, taped to another harness near the emergency brake pedal.
